springboot并发调优的方法有哪些
使用线程池:Spring Boot中可以配置线程池来管理线程的创建和销毁,通过配置合适的线程池大小、队列长度等参数,可以有效控制并发请求的处理能力。 异步处理:Sp...
使用线程池:Spring Boot中可以配置线程池来管理线程的创建和销毁,通过配置合适的线程池大小、队列长度等参数,可以有效控制并发请求的处理能力。 异步处理:Sp...
当Spring Boot应用程序在并发访问时变慢,可能有以下几个原因和解决方法: 数据库连接池配置不合理:确保数据库连接池的最大连接数和最小空闲连接数适当配置。可...
默认情况下,Spring Boot 的文件上传大小受限制,可以通过以下几种方式解决: 修改 application.properties 文件:在 application.properties 文件中添加以下配置...
Spring Boot中文件上传的方式有以下几种: 使用MultipartFile接口:MultipartFile是Spring框架提供的接口,可以通过它来处理文件上传。可以在Controller的方法参...
Spring Boot有多种方法可以打包和运行应用程序。以下是其中一种常见的方法: 使用Maven或Gradle构建项目,并将应用程序打包为可执行的JAR文件。 使用Maven:在项...
Spring Boot项目的打包和部署方法有多种选择。下面是一种常见的方法:1. 打包项目:使用以下命令在项目的根目录下执行Maven或Gradle命令来打包项目。 - 使用Mave...
Spring Boot本身并不提供数据权限的功能,但可以通过一些第三方库或自定义代码来实现数据权限。
以下是一种基本的实现思路: 定义数据权限规则:确定数据权...
在Spring Boot中,可以使用RestTemplate或Feign来调用外部接口。 RestTemplate调用外部接口: @Autowired
private RestTemplate restTemplate;
public...
在Spring Boot中,可以使用Spring Security来限制接口的访问。Spring Security是一个基于Spring框架的安全性解决方案,可以帮助我们实现认证和授权的功能。
在Spring Boot中,可以使用@RequestParam注解来接收表单数据。以下是示例代码:
@PostMapping("/submit")
public String submitForm(@RequestParam("n...